electroandy wrote:Another Push request is to allow a grouped set of tracks to be expanded using the same button that expands devices etc. It's a pain having to click the expand button on the computer to access the instruments that exist within a group.
You can already do this. Simply hold down the Group track's Track Selection Button to expand/collapse it.
